## Deployment

This release of the Fernwick API resolves the long-standing GraphQL N+1 problem on the catalog resolvers. Nested product queries now batch through a dataloader layer instead of issuing one database call per node, cutting typical query latency by roughly two-thirds. As the incoming contractor, note that the batching layer is enabled per environment and must be switched on explicitly when you deploy. Rollout order is staging first, then the two production cells. The deployment reads its settings from the values below.

settings of fafog-haduf:
ZORIX_PIN=4648
ZORIX_METRICS_HOST=metrics.zorix.paliqsys.corp
ZORIX_LOG_LEVEL=info
ZORIX_TENANT=druix

Replica lag alarm on the Tarnfield cluster keeps paging overnight. Root cause: batch exports from Ledgerpine saturate the primary, replicas fall behind, alarm fires at a threshold set years ago. Do not raise the threshold blindly. We scale read capacity when sustained lag exceeds the warning band for two evaluation windows. Alarms route through Opsgrove. The current constants governing lag evaluation and replica autoscaling are as follows.

constants for bawif-kawif:
QUOTAS = {
    "ulaael": 5,
    "holael": 10,
}

Subject: Currency rounding — read before your first shift

Welcome to on-call for Coinloom. Plugin authors will file tickets about "missing cents" in converted totals. Almost always it's their plugin rounding before calling our convert hook instead of after. Don't patch anything yourself; point them at the integration guide and tag the Ledger team if totals drift by more than one unit. The triage checklist and known-issues list live on this page.

operations page: https://confluence.qorvellabs.internal/pages/projects/projects/projects

# Artifact Signing — ChronoPlan Timetable Solver

All release artifacts for the ChronoPlan school timetable solver must be signed before upload to the Westbrook artifact store. The on-call engineer verifies each build's signature prior to promotion; unsigned or mismatched artifacts must be quarantined and escalated. Rotation happens quarterly, and stale keys are revoked within 24 hours. If verification fails, do not retry with an older key. The currently active signing key is listed below.

rollout seal: bky9_PeXH1fTLY